Home
last modified time | relevance | path

Searched refs:setup_force_cpu_cap (Results 1 – 22 of 22) sorted by relevance

/linux-6.6.21/arch/x86/kernel/cpu/
Dtsx.c154 setup_force_cpu_cap(X86_FEATURE_RTM_ALWAYS_ABORT); in tsx_dev_mode_disable()
190 setup_force_cpu_cap(X86_FEATURE_MSR_TSX_CTRL); in tsx_init()
242 setup_force_cpu_cap(X86_FEATURE_RTM); in tsx_init()
243 setup_force_cpu_cap(X86_FEATURE_HLE); in tsx_init()
Dbugs.c252 setup_force_cpu_cap(X86_FEATURE_CLEAR_CPU_BUF); in mds_select_mitigation()
356 setup_force_cpu_cap(X86_FEATURE_CLEAR_CPU_BUF); in taa_select_mitigation()
424 setup_force_cpu_cap(X86_FEATURE_CLEAR_CPU_BUF); in mmio_select_mitigation()
871 setup_force_cpu_cap(X86_FEATURE_FENCE_SWAPGS_USER); in spectre_v1_select_mitigation()
878 setup_force_cpu_cap(X86_FEATURE_FENCE_SWAPGS_KERNEL); in spectre_v1_select_mitigation()
1039 setup_force_cpu_cap(X86_FEATURE_RETHUNK); in retbleed_select_mitigation()
1040 setup_force_cpu_cap(X86_FEATURE_UNRET); in retbleed_select_mitigation()
1053 setup_force_cpu_cap(X86_FEATURE_ENTRY_IBPB); in retbleed_select_mitigation()
1054 setup_force_cpu_cap(X86_FEATURE_IBPB_ON_VMEXIT); in retbleed_select_mitigation()
1059 setup_force_cpu_cap(X86_FEATURE_RETHUNK); in retbleed_select_mitigation()
[all …]
Dvmware.c380 setup_force_cpu_cap(X86_FEATURE_CONSTANT_TSC); in vmware_set_capabilities()
381 setup_force_cpu_cap(X86_FEATURE_TSC_RELIABLE); in vmware_set_capabilities()
383 setup_force_cpu_cap(X86_FEATURE_TSC_KNOWN_FREQ); in vmware_set_capabilities()
385 setup_force_cpu_cap(X86_FEATURE_VMCALL); in vmware_set_capabilities()
387 setup_force_cpu_cap(X86_FEATURE_VMW_VMMCALL); in vmware_set_capabilities()
Damd.c616 setup_force_cpu_cap(X86_FEATURE_LS_CFG_SSBD); in bsp_init_amd()
617 setup_force_cpu_cap(X86_FEATURE_SSBD); in bsp_init_amd()
776 setup_force_cpu_cap(X86_FEATURE_IBPB_BRTYPE); in early_init_amd()
778 setup_force_cpu_cap(X86_FEATURE_IBPB_BRTYPE); in early_init_amd()
779 setup_force_cpu_cap(X86_FEATURE_SBPB); in early_init_amd()
Dhygon.c238 setup_force_cpu_cap(X86_FEATURE_LS_CFG_SSBD); in bsp_init_hygon()
239 setup_force_cpu_cap(X86_FEATURE_SSBD); in bsp_init_hygon()
Dcommon.c527 setup_force_cpu_cap(X86_FEATURE_OSPKE); in setup_pku()
1362 setup_force_cpu_cap(X86_FEATURE_IBRS_ENHANCED); in cpu_set_bug_bits()
1475 setup_force_cpu_cap(X86_FEATURE_NOPL); in detect_nopl()
1605 setup_force_cpu_cap(X86_FEATURE_CPUID); in early_identify_cpu()
1620 setup_force_cpu_cap(X86_FEATURE_ALWAYS); in early_identify_cpu()
Dmshyperv.c510 setup_force_cpu_cap(X86_FEATURE_TSC_RELIABLE); in ms_hyperv_init_platform()
Dintel.c1112 setup_force_cpu_cap(X86_FEATURE_SPLIT_LOCK_DETECT); in __split_lock_setup()
/linux-6.6.21/arch/x86/kernel/
Dparavirt-spinlocks.c39 setup_force_cpu_cap(X86_FEATURE_PVUNLOCK); in paravirt_set_cap()
42 setup_force_cpu_cap(X86_FEATURE_VCPUPREEMPT); in paravirt_set_cap()
Dtsc_msr.c223 setup_force_cpu_cap(X86_FEATURE_TSC_KNOWN_FREQ); in cpu_khz_from_msr()
233 setup_force_cpu_cap(X86_FEATURE_TSC_RELIABLE); in cpu_khz_from_msr()
Djailhouse.c256 setup_force_cpu_cap(X86_FEATURE_TSC_KNOWN_FREQ); in jailhouse_init_platform()
Dtsc.c694 setup_force_cpu_cap(X86_FEATURE_TSC_KNOWN_FREQ); in native_calibrate_tsc()
717 setup_force_cpu_cap(X86_FEATURE_TSC_RELIABLE); in native_calibrate_tsc()
1101 setup_force_cpu_cap(X86_FEATURE_ART); in detect_art()
Dkvmclock.c119 setup_force_cpu_cap(X86_FEATURE_TSC_KNOWN_FREQ); in kvm_get_tsc_khz()
/linux-6.6.21/arch/um/include/asm/
Dcpufeature.h61 #define setup_force_cpu_cap(bit) do { \ macro
66 #define setup_force_cpu_bug(bit) setup_force_cpu_cap(bit)
/linux-6.6.21/arch/x86/include/asm/
Dcpufeature.h149 #define setup_force_cpu_cap(bit) do { \ macro
154 #define setup_force_cpu_bug(bit) setup_force_cpu_cap(bit)
/linux-6.6.21/arch/x86/kernel/fpu/
Dinit.c79 setup_force_cpu_cap(X86_FEATURE_FPU); in fpu__init_system_early_generic()
Dxstate.c834 setup_force_cpu_cap(X86_FEATURE_XCOMPACTED); in fpu__init_system_xstate()
886 setup_force_cpu_cap(X86_FEATURE_OSXSAVE); in fpu__init_system_xstate()
/linux-6.6.21/arch/x86/xen/
Dtime.c43 setup_force_cpu_cap(X86_FEATURE_TSC_KNOWN_FREQ); in xen_tsc_khz()
541 setup_force_cpu_cap(X86_FEATURE_TSC); in xen_time_init()
Denlighten_pv.c337 setup_force_cpu_cap(X86_FEATURE_XENPV); in xen_init_capabilities()
356 setup_force_cpu_cap(X86_FEATURE_MWAIT); in xen_init_capabilities()
/linux-6.6.21/arch/x86/mm/
Dpti.c121 setup_force_cpu_cap(X86_FEATURE_PTI); in pti_check_boottime_disable()
/linux-6.6.21/arch/x86/coco/tdx/
Dtdx.c771 setup_force_cpu_cap(X86_FEATURE_TDX_GUEST); in tdx_early_init()
/linux-6.6.21/Documentation/arch/x86/
Dcpuinfo.rst65 setup_force_cpu_cap macros. For example, if bit 5 is set in MSR_IA32_CORE_CAPS,